Detail

A vulnerability has been found in IROAD Dash Cam X5 and Dash Cam X6 up to 20250308 and classified as problematic. This vulnerability affects unknown code of the component Domain Handler. The manipulation of the argument Domain Name leads to origin validation error. The attack can be initiated remotely. The complexity of an attack is rather high. The exploitation appears to be difficult.
